• Vui lòng đọc nội qui diễn đàn để tránh bị xóa bài viết
  • Tìm kiếm trước khi đặt câu hỏi

Nhờ giúp truy vấn lấy ghép dòng dữ liệu.

Chuyên mục thảo luận các vấn đề liên quan đến ứng dụng quản lý và cơ sở dữ liệu

Moderator: Điều hành

muaphonui_2010
Thành viên ưu tú
Thành viên ưu tú
Posts: 541
Joined: Fri 26/11/2010 1:15 pm
Location: TP.HCM
Has thanked: 189 times
Been thanked: 33 times
Contact:

Nhờ giúp truy vấn lấy ghép dòng dữ liệu.

Postby muaphonui_2010 » Wed 30/11/2016 4:32 pm

CHào các bạn. Nhờ các bạn xem giúp mình trường hợp này thử được không với nhé.

Giả sử mình có 2 bảng dữ liệu như sau:
Bảng 1 (bán hàng)
SoPhieu------NgayThang----------Sotien
00001-------01/01/2015--------1.000.000
00002-------03/01/2015--------2.000.000
00003-------05/01/2015--------3.000.000
00004-------07/01/2015--------4.000.000


Bảng 2 (Thu Tiền)
SoPhieu------NgayThang--------Sotien
00001--------07/01/2015--------500.000
00001--------08/01/2015--------500.000
00002--------09/01/2015--------2.000.000
00003--------09/01/2015--------1.000.000
00003--------10/01/2015--------2.000.000


2 bảng trên liên kết với nhau qua cột Số Phiếu
==> Mình muốn dựa vào dữ liệu bảng số 1 làm gốc kết hợp với bảng 2 để ra được kết quả là:

SoPhieu------NgayThang----------Sotien----------------ngaythu------------------------------sotien
00001--------01/01/2015--------1.000.000--------07/01/2015, 08/01/2015 ----------------1.000.000
00002--------03/01/2015--------2.000.000--------09/01/2015-------------------------------2.000.000
00003--------05/01/2015--------3.000.000--------09/01/2015, 10/01/2015-----------------3.000.000
00004--------07/01/2015--------4.000.000----------------------------------------------------0

Không biết có làm được như trên không các bạn.
Nhu cầu thực tế là:
Khi mình bán 1 đơn hàng thì khách trả tiền cho đơn hàng đó trong nhiều ngày. ==> Làm sao thấy được các ngày người ta trả theo đơn hàng bán.

Nếu làm ở VB.Net thì mình làm được bằng cách For từng dòng bán hàng rồi lấy dữ liệu thu lên rồi ghép lại thành chuổi rồi điền vào cell.

Cảm ơn các bạn
hy vọng có cách hay hơn .



muaphonui_2010
Thành viên ưu tú
Thành viên ưu tú
Posts: 541
Joined: Fri 26/11/2010 1:15 pm
Location: TP.HCM
Has thanked: 189 times
Been thanked: 33 times
Contact:

Re: Nhờ giúp truy vấn lấy ghép dòng dữ liệu.

Postby muaphonui_2010 » Wed 30/11/2016 9:10 pm

Mình làm được rồi nha các bạn.
Mình làm theo link này
http://stackoverflow.com/questions/8005 ... to-one-row


Return to “Ứng dụng Quản lý và Cơ sở dữ liệu”

Who is online

Users browsing this forum: No registered users and 1 guest